What is SketchUp?
SketchUp, developed by Trimble Inc., is a user-friendly 3D modeling software that allows users to create and visualize their ideas in three dimensions. It offers a range of tools and features that make it easy to create detailed models of interior spaces.

Creating 3D Models
One of the main advantages of using SketchUp in interior design is its ability to create highly detailed 3D models. With its intuitive interface and powerful tools, users can easily draw walls, floors, ceilings, windows, doors, furniture, and other elements to accurately represent the space they are designing.

Features for Interior Designers
SketchUp provides several features specifically tailored for interior designers:

  • Materials and Textures: SketchUp allows users to apply different materials and textures to their models. This feature enables designers to visualize how different finishes will look in their designs.
  • Lighting: Lighting plays a crucial role in interior design.

    SketchUp provides various lighting options such as directional lights and point lights, allowing designers to experiment with different lighting scenarios.

  • Extensions: SketchUp has an extensive library of extensions that further enhance its functionality. There are several extensions available specifically for interior design purposes, such as furniture libraries and rendering plugins.

Presenting Designs
One of the key benefits of using SketchUp in interior design is its ability to present designs effectively:

1. Photorealistic Renderings

SketchUp allows designers to create stunning, photorealistic renderings of their designs. By applying realistic materials, textures, and lighting effects, users can bring their designs to life and showcase them to clients or stakeholders.

2. Walkthroughs and Flyovers

SketchUp enables users to create interactive walkthroughs and flyovers of their designs. This feature is incredibly useful for presenting the spatial layout of a design and giving clients a virtual tour of the space.

3. 360-Degree Panoramas

With SketchUp, designers can create immersive 360-degree panoramas of their designs. This feature allows clients to explore the design from all angles and get a better understanding of how the space will look and feel.
